SEN / EHCP Support Assistant "Good" Secondary School located in Central London / Westminster is looking for an SEN / EHCP Support Assistant, who is available ASAP. This role shall be for the remainder of the academic year with scope for further extension. The role will involve basic admin, submission of EHCP, potentially carrying out assessments (pending experience), working with specialist SEN staff and much more. The position is open to both SENCo, Assistant SENCo or individuals who have previous experience with supporting SEN or carrying out EHCP duties – the role is very much dependent on the appointed SEN / EHCP Support Assistant. Job Details Supporting EHCP applications Working alongside the current SENCo & SEN Team Basic admin duties Carrying out assessments (pending experience) ASAP start Full Time – Term Time Only Salary: £26,500 Location: Borough Westminster Person Specification Confident in working in a fast‑paced environment Previous EHCPs or SEN experience would be ideal Capable of carrying out data/admin tasks to a high level Able to work within a large team School Details Graded ‘Good’ in latest Ofsted report Large secondary school – mixed gender and multi‑cultural Strong SLT in place – Fantastic Executive Head Teacher Creative and forward‑thinking ethos throughout the secondary school Fantastic CPD opportunities on offerLocated in the Borough of Westminster If you are interested, visits to the school can be arranged immediately.
